       1. How do I buy items from Baycrafts?

You will need to register first at baycrafts before you can use our shopping cart. This is done to discourage bogus buyers who simply click away for fun, inundating our inbox with fake orders.

When registered, you can use our cart and simply “add item” to your shopping cart. After you have done this, you will go to our check-out counter where you will be asked to provide your preferred mode of payment and shipping address.

At present, we do not have tie-ups with major credit cards and at most, can only accept bank to bank transactions, g-cash or remittances through couriers such as LBC Peso Pak, JRS or Western Union.

2. Is there a minimum number of items that I need to buy ?

No. You can buy as many as you want, or you can buy only one item. The buyer shoulders the shipping, so we do not have a minimum purchase.

However, for international buyers, we do recommend to purchase at least 1 kg in weight to maximize your shipping cost.

3. How do I pay for the items?

If you’re in the Philippines, there are several payment options available to you: You can pay us via Bank to bank transactions : UCPB, BPI, G-cash, LBC Peso Pack, JRS Padala and Western Union.

If you’re in the United States, you can pay us via xoom.com using paypal or e-checks.

If you’re in another location abroad, you can pay us via bank transfers using  UCPB , BPI or Western Union. However, we only ship after we have received payment, and as this will take a week or so, shipment might be delayed.

 4. How do I receive the items?

For buyers located in the Philippines, we use Overseas Courier Service (OCS) , which is a one-day door-to-door  delivery. For areas not covered by OCS, we use JRS. However, JRS charges a higher shipping rate.

For buyers outside Philippines, we can use our Postal System. This is cheaper than using international couriers, but delivery can take up to 15 days to reach you. For buyers wanting immediate delivery, international carriers charge $20 to $22 dollars per 1 kilogram.

10. How do I know if you are a reliable and genuine seller?

Baycrafts is technically a 2 year old company, registered with the Philippine’s Department of Trade and Industry. It started out as a brick and mortar business under R.Olano’s Handicrafts, its parent company, which is a handicraft goods retailer at the Naga City Supermarket  located in Naga City, Philippines.

Recently, it has ventured into online trading by putting up Baycrafts.net. But before that, Baycrafts has been selling through Ebay, under its owner’s alias “Jessicaz28”.  You can check out Jessicaz28’s feedbacks, which are 100% positive. In fact, some of the initial buyers of Baycrafts are previous buyers from Ebay.

11. Are the products featured in Baycrafts exclusively made?

Baycrafts is a trader /  manufacturer of costume jewelry products. So most of the products (but not all) are manufactured by us. However, our aim is to provide the best collection of the latest fashion in costume jewelry, so we buy items from time to time from our reliable suppliers.
